Systems Support Assistant assists in the installation, maintenance, and general support of systems. Assists users with questions or problems. Being a Systems Support Assistant may help perform system backups and recovery and install new software. May require an associate degree or equivalent. Additionally, Systems Support Assistant typ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Systems Support Assistant works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. To be a Systems Support Assistant typically requires 1-3 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
IT support & administration. This position reports to the IT Systems Manager & will work closely with systems administrators, engineers, and security personnel. Excellent opportunity to expand skills & gain experience in a variety of IT systems administration, infrastructure, networking & security related areas.
Service Delivery: This person will serve as a direct point of contact for internal Information Systems customers and respond to end-user requests & needs, with the primary focus being customer service & Level 1-2 problem resolution. This person will gather all relevant technical information necessary to resolve issues & respond to user questions/inquiries in a timely, accurate, & professional manner. This person will proactively communicate with end-users regarding the progress of the resolution, keeping ownership throughout the progress & working to ensure customer satisfaction. Documents & escalates support requests to other department staff & Network Administrator as needed.
Administration: Assist the Network Administrator in maintaining the IT systems for Verified Credentials. This includes user endpoints (workstations, laptops, phones, desktop software, etc.), printers/scanners, Active Directory user account administration, antivirus tools, MS Exchange, Outlook and the O365 software suite.
